    Default Fernando Vargas - Great?

    Fernando Vargas - Great? :P

    I see many people put Fernando Vargas down.

    I admit I am a fan of his, I like his style, he looks the part, and he is your typical "say what he feels like" boxer, who can get alot of peoples tails up. But if he wasnt like that....it just wouldnt be Vargas, would it?

    Many people will argue he choked at his career defining fights, maybe, but if I was a boxer I wouldnt be too down harted having Oscar de La Hoya, Felix Trinindad and Shane Moseley as my own losses in a 29 fight career, which still has a lot to give.

    To have names as Raul Marquez, Ike Quartey and possibly the P4P best in World Boxing today, Ronald "Winky "Wright, some credit is deserved.

    I think a great point to Vargas, is that he fight anyone who wants to get in the ring with him. He is afraid of no-one, he doesnt duck and dodge nobody. How many other so called P4P greats today do this, they are more bothered about fighting second rate opponents to keep there Loss record to "0".

    He also has been a World Champion, I know its easier to get your hands on these days, but it is still why boxers box. To become the very best, and as a World Champion in most cases, you have to be uop there with them.

    You cant argue either that Vargas isnt value for money. Again how many supposedly P4P top boxers today, have put on value for money matches, like Vargas has. The guy has been in wars, and fights that for me that will go down in history as being some of the best wars ever.

    He has heart, ability, desire, he has alot more than many, and for me, his name will go down in history for what he has done in his career.

    He still has a lot to give, and it wouldnt surprise me if he has another World Title somewhere down the line.

    So in conclusion, for me....

    Fernando Vargas = Great
